Robin Uthappa recalls the day Virat Kohli batted through grief

In 2006, Virat Kohli displayed remarkable dedication by playing a Ranji Trophy match against Karnataka shortly after his father's death. Despite the personal tragedy, the 18-year-old scored 90 runs, preventing a follow-on. Robin Uthappa, who played in that game, recalls Kohli's resolute demeanor and controlled batting, noting a quiet strength beyond the usual fiery aggression.
